<u>ANSWER:</u>

Scaffolding is the process of supporting children by giving detailed instructions at each step of the activity.

<u>EXPLANATION:</u>

  • The process of scaffolding aims to make the child a master of every activity that the child does.
  • Scaffolding requires an adult to instruct and support the child whenever a new activity is being done by the child. The adult provides support and instructions at each step of the activity but allows the child to do the activity.
  • This way, the child learns how to perform the task and by performing it over and over again masters it. At this time, the support of the adult must be withdrawn.
